MANUFACTURING ENGINEER (NEW GRAD DECEMBER 2026)

Freeform builds AI-native manufacturing systems that unify software, hardware, and physics to produce industrial-scale parts at the speed of human ideation. By treating manufacturing as a single integrated system, we unlock a new era of innovation where complex hardware is designed, built, and scaled without limits.  

As a Manufacturing Engineer at Freeform, you’ll be at the forefront of scaling production for high-performance metal 3D printed parts. You’ll work with a talented engineering team from some of the world’s most innovative companies across a range of projects to develop and refine the processes, tooling, and CNC machining workflows that enable precision manufacturing at speed and scale. This role is hands-on and fast-paced, ideal for someone eager to learn and contribute to the development of our autonomous metal 3D printing factories. You’ll focus on optimizing post-processing and machining operations, helping to bridge the gap between R&D and production.  

3D printing experience is not required to be successful here - rather we look for smart, motivated, collaborative individuals who love solving hard problems and creating amazing technology!  

Responsibilities:  

  • Work closely with engineers to design and implement scalable manufacturing processes for new hardware and printed parts 
  • Support part flow through the factory by improving fixturing, test procedures, and post-processing steps 
  • Develop lightweight documentation and process standards to support scaling production without slowing engineering iteration 
  • Build and iterate on tooling, jigs, and test setups to support reliable, high-throughput production 
  • Help identify bottlenecks and inefficiencies in how parts, materials, and data move through the factory, and work with cross-functional teams to improve them 
  • Support early production of high-performance printed parts, helping bridge the gap between R&D and high-rate manufacturing 
  • Contribute to CNC machining workflows, including programming, setup, and optimization of multi-axis operations for post-processing of printed parts
